中文摘要:
      鉴于西部地区粮食生产总体水平较低,资源利用效率低下,危及农业持续发展,选取陕西省安塞县作为案例,通过分析当地粮食生产的资源条件,对粮食生产的资源利用效率展开综合评价,在此基础上从资源配置、利用模式和生产技术方面分析了资源低效利用原因,并从合理配置资源、优化利用模式和集成技术体系有机结合方面探讨了粮食生产的资源高效利用对策。
英文摘要:
      Grain security and the related security of resources and environment have been the grave trail for China's security stratage, which is now arousing more and more attention from both governmet and ordinary people. When confronted with heavy and increasing population pressure, the most promising way (maybe the only way) to resolving the grain security of China is to increase the efficiency of utilizing available resources and adheres to efficient and sustainable development to a great degree, or the grain security will still be the obsessing haze hovering over the nation for a long time. In view of the fact that the level of grain production in the west regions of China is generally low and the efficiency of resources utilization in grain production there is especially low (which has already become the great menace for agriculture sustainable development there), this paper selected Ansai County of Shaanxi Province as the case area. In the paper, the resources condition of grain production was first analyzed, and the resources utilization efficiency of grain production was then assessed. Based on these, the paper analyzed the causes for inefficient resources utilization of grain production through different angles of resources allocation, utilization patterns and agriculture technology, and finally explored the countermeasures for efficient resources utilization in grain production, namely synthesizing rational resources allocation, optimal utilization patterns and integrated technology system.
